Jamaica Average Secondary Enrollment 1973-2025
75.56%
Jamaica's average secondary enrollment from 1973 to 2025 was 75.56%, based on 42 data points.
All Data (sorted by year)▾
| Year | Value | Change | Rank |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 84.55% | −0.89pp | 119th |
| 2023 | 85.44% | +2.58pp | 100th |
| 2022 | 82.86% | −2.95pp | 109th |
| 2021 | 85.81% | +4.28pp | 103rd |
| 2020 | 81.53% | −4.23pp | 112th |
| 2019 | 85.76% | +2.00pp | 98th |
| 2018 | 83.76% | −0.48pp | 98th |
| 2017 | 84.24% | −3.70pp | 96th |
| 2016 | 87.94% | +2.58pp | 89th |
| 2015 | 85.35% | −1.02pp | 100th |
| 2014 | 86.37% | +0.97pp | 93rd |
| 2013 | 85.40% | −6.14pp | 87th |
| 2011 | 91.54% | +2.04pp | 74th |
| 2010 | 89.49% | −0.68pp | 76th |
| 2009 | 90.17% | +2.12pp | 65th |
